The Importance Of Lyo Vials In The Pharmaceutical Industry
In the field of pharmaceuticals, the use of lyophilized products has become increasingly popular due to the numerous benefits it offers. Lyophilization, also known as freeze-drying, is a process that involves removing water from a material after it has been frozen and placing it under a vacuum, allowing the ice to sublimate directly from solid to vapor without passing through the liquid phase. The result is a product that is stable, preserves the integrity of the active ingredients, and has a longer shelf life.
One crucial component in the lyophilization process is the lyo vial. lyo vials are specially designed containers that hold the product to be freeze-dried. These vials are typically made of borosilicate glass, a type of glass that is resistant to changes in temperature and pressure. The use of borosilicate glass ensures that the vials can withstand the extreme conditions of the lyophilization process without breaking or cracking.
